Is it OK to give baby cow’s milk at 11 months?

Contents show

You should be aware that for kids younger than 12 months, the American Academy of Pediatrics still suggests a combination of solid foods and breastmilk or formula. They only advise introducing whole cow’s milk after a year.

Can I give my 11 month old regular milk?

Your child can be given cow’s milk starting at 12 months old (but not earlier). The consumption of cow’s milk may increase your child’s risk of intestinal bleeding before the age of twelve months. Additionally, it lacks the proper quantity of nutrients your baby requires and contains too many proteins and minerals for your baby’s kidneys to process.

How do I introduce milk to my 11 month old?

Start by substituting a sippy cup or standard cup of full cow’s milk for one feeding each day. Mix one-half cow’s milk with one-half breast milk or formula if your baby doesn’t like it. Reduce the ratio gradually over time. Until you are no longer nursing or using formula, gradually replace other feedings with cow’s milk.

Why is toddler milk harmful?

Powdered milk and corn syrup solids are both included in infant formulae, however the FDA rigorously monitors the nutritional content of all formulas intended for infants less than 12 months. Without those dietary restrictions, the majority of toddler milks include higher levels of sugar, fat, and salt than baby formula.

How do I switch from formula to cow’s milk?

To start, just add a small amount of milk (such as one ounce) so that your baby is consuming formula. In order to help your child gradually grow acclimated to the flavor, add more milk and less formula to the bottles every few days. You can eventually go from using any formula at all to only using milk in the bottles or cups.

Is cow milk good for 1 year baby?

However, beyond the age of one year, giving cow’s milk to children is safe. Only whole milk should be given to a child who is 1 or 2 years old. This is because your child’s developing brain needs the fat in whole milk. After the age of two, kids who are overweight can consume skim milk or low-fat milk.

Why do you stop formula at 12 months?

Because a child’s digestive system is ready to handle toddler formula or unsweetened cow’s milk at 12 months of age. Breast milk or infant formula (formulated to closely resemble the composition of breast milk) is simpler to digest before this point.

Why is cow’s milk bad for babies?

High levels of protein and minerals in cow’s milk can strain a newborn’s developing kidneys and lead to life-threatening illness during times of heat stress, fever, or diarrhea. Cow’s milk also lacks the essential amounts of iron, vitamin C, and other nutrients that young children require.
